RallyRACC, three days ahead: reconnaissance starts


 

The reconnaissance of the special stages by the participants of the 43 RallyRACC Catalunya-COSTA DAURADA, Rally de Espaņa, twelfth scoring round of the World Rally Championship to be staged from next Friday to Sunday (5 to 7 October), will be carried out today, Tuesday, October 2nd and tomorrow Wednesday, 3rd, from 08.00 a.m. to 19.00 p.m. Reconnaissance is not the same as testing, since it is carried out on roads open to usual traffic, at reduced speed, never in opposite direction to what is indicated and always respecting the Road Traffic Regulations as well as all regulations as regards safety and the rights of other road users. Drivers appointed by the FIA must fit a speed control system - GPS - in their reconnaissance cars.

These reconnaissance routes are strictly controlled by the organisation. At the start and finish of every stage, the officials in charge of controlling, take note of the vehicle taking part in reconnaissance and stamp the respective form to control every passage of participants through the timed stages. During the administrative checks, RACC Motor Sport has given all participants a sticker to be stuck onto the service vehicle which they will be using during reconnaissance and a form that will allow only two passages of every stage. According to the colour of this sticker, every car has to start reconnaissance with a group of certain stages, thus avoiding congestion. Reconnaissance has to be made with vehicles that comply with what is established by the FIA, basically standard model cars, without any external markings, suitable for travelling on open roads.

Today, Tuesday, drivers can cover the stages of Querol, El Montmell, El Lloar-La Figuera, Vilaplana, La Serra d'Almos and Colldejou, while the stages of Pratdip, Coll del Grau, Margalef-La Palma d'Ebre, Riudecanyes and the Shakedown stage, i.e. La Serra d'Almos in the opposite direction will be covered tomorrow. A chicane will be set-up on the El Montmell stage during the race to slow down the passage of the cars, which will be already installed and signposted during the reconnaissance, although participants will have to follow the safety instructions of the rally officials, since the stage, as well as the rest of the route, will be open to traffic during the reconnaissance.

As in all other races of the WRC, any driver not entered to this race is allowed to do the Rally RACC reconnaissance with a view to a possible participation in the World Championship in the coming years. In this case, the driver will have to pay the corresponding fee and follow the reconnaissance programme.

The Media Centre starts working tomorrow

This afternoon (Tuesday) the accreditation of the attending media representative will start and from 08h00 a.m. tomorrow, the Media Centre will start working, located in the halls of the Hotel PortAventura, close to the Headquarters. For more information, visit www.rallyracc.com.
